MARTINEZ RAMOS, Gilberto; TORRES FRAGUELA, Salvador; GONZALEZ DELIS, Remberto and GARRIDO LENA, Lilia Isabel. Comportamiento de la cirugía mayor ambulatoria: Estudio de 5 años. Rev Cubana Cir [online]. 2003, vol.42, n.4, pp. 0-0. ISSN 1561-2945.
A descriptive, cross-sectional and prospective study was conducted among 2 208 patients operated on by ambulatory major surgery at the surgery service of "Comandante Manuel Fajardo Rivero" Military Clinical and Surgical Hospital, in Santa Clara, from January, 1997, to December, 2001, aimed at showing the advantages of this method for the patient and the health institution. The patients operated on of inguinal, epigastric and umbilical hernias predominated. This method was also used with vesicular lithiasis, uterine fibromyomas, breast nodules, gynecomasties and hemorrhoids. Most of the patients were females and the groups aged 20-49 were the most benefitted with this method. The types of anesthesia preferably used were regional anesthesia and acupunctural surgical analgesia
